This book offers a comprehensive guide to applying Python programming in the field of mechanical engineering. It is designed to provide readers with both foundational knowledge in Python and practical skills for solving real-world engineering problems. The content begins by introducing the essentials of Python, from basic syntax and functions to loops and modules, enabling readers to build a solid programming foundation. Along with configuring the development environment, readers will explore various key concepts necessary for writing efficient Python code. The book then delves into practical applications that directly relate to mechanical engineering. It features projects and simulations, such as analyzing cyclist air resistance, simulating the kinematics of a robotic arm, studying Otto cycle efficiency, exploring damped pendulum motion, and analyzing and visualizing engine data. Through these hands-on exercises, readers will learn how to apply Python in different engineering contexts, developing skills in numerical computation, data analysis, and simulation. Tailored specifically for mechanical engineers, the book addresses the unique challenges faced in this field. It emphasizes practical learning, encouraging readers to engage with real-world problems, analyze data, and utilize Python to enhance their engineering capabilities. Whether you are a student or a professional, this guide provides valuable insights and methods to effectively use Python in mechanical engineering applications.
